• Gluten-Free Seed Crackers with Västerbottensost Cheese

    A gluten-free seed cracker with Västerbottensost cheese, topped with flaked salt—so good you can’t stop eating it! A delicious, crunchy flavor from chia seeds, sesame seeds, and sunflower seeds.

    Perfect as a snack or as an accompaniment to a cheese platter. If you omit the grated cheese from the recipe, it goes even better with any meal of the day. If you want to cut back on the salt, just skip the flaked salt on top of the crispbread. The dough is very easy to both mix together and roll out.

    Here's how:

    • 1

      Dissolve the yeast in the water and stir in the chia seeds; let stand for about 10 minutes. Mix in the remaining ingredients except for the cheese, which you’ll stir in at the end. Stir for a couple of minutes with a spoon or mix slowly for a minute or so in a food processor.

    • 2

      Let the dough rise at room temperature for 60 minutes, covered with plastic wrap or a kitchen towel.

    • 3

      Divide the dough into two portions and roll out each portion thinly between two sheets of parchment paper, making sure each piece is the same size as the baking sheet.

    • 4

      Top with flaky salt, or skip the salt if you want to cut back on your salt intake.

    • 5

      Let the pans sit at room temperature for 30 minutes; there is no need to cover them.

    • 6

      Preheat the oven to 150 °C.

    • 7

      Bake the crispbread for about 30 minutes or until it is hard and crispy.

    Ingredients

    • 25 g (1/2 packet) KronJäst for Bread, fresh
    • 250 g (2.5 dl) cold water 
    • 84 g (about 1.5 dl) cornmeal
    • 68 g (about 1 dl) rice flour
    • 12 g (about 1 tbsp) rosehip peel flour
    • 20 g (1 tbsp) honey
    • 6 g (1 tsp) salt
    • 210 g (2 dl) sesame seeds
    • 116 g (2 dl) sunflower seeds
    • 22 g (2 tbsp) chia seeds
    • 150 g (3 dl) Västerbottensost, grated 
    • 39 g (3 tbsp) olive oil

    Topping

    • flaked salt
